Output e8bbb0f25498a3632d2e655f524c9e18404f139fa13ff77ff18e0ce331894908:0

value
1599872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ee2caac68b7c43f89be3958a4966c8a3984b5ed9 OP_EQUAL
address
3PQNFiudVTC4X1abELm6GCBxfEFryzSUCg
transaction
e8bbb0f25498a3632d2e655f524c9e18404f139fa13ff77ff18e0ce331894908
spent
true